From: Tom Lane Date: Mon, 2 Mar 2020 23:41:50 +0000 (-0500) Subject: Fix possibly-uninitialized variable. X-Git-Tag: REL_13_BETA1~629 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=91f3bd732cea7e25e53eaceae88232d0ab984434;p=thirdparty%2Fpostgresql.git Fix possibly-uninitialized variable. Thinko in 2f9661311. Per buildfarm, as well as warning seen locally. --- diff --git a/contrib/pg_stat_statements/pg_stat_statements.c b/contrib/pg_stat_statements/pg_stat_statements.c index 7d9a1de2e0b..20dc8c605bf 100644 --- a/contrib/pg_stat_statements/pg_stat_statements.c +++ b/contrib/pg_stat_statements/pg_stat_statements.c @@ -1013,8 +1013,7 @@ pgss_ProcessUtility(PlannedStmt *pstmt, const char *queryString, INSTR_TIME_SET_CURRENT(duration); INSTR_TIME_SUBTRACT(duration, start); - if (qc) - rows = qc->commandTag == CMDTAG_COPY ? qc->nprocessed : 0; + rows = (qc && qc->commandTag == CMDTAG_COPY) ? qc->nprocessed : 0; /* calc differences of buffer counters. */ bufusage.shared_blks_hit =